Impact of UK Sports Events on Social Cohesion

UK sports events play a vital role in fostering social cohesion by bringing together diverse groups within communities. Through shared experiences at football matches, marathons, and cricket games, local residents cultivate a stronger local identity. These events act as social glue, encouraging interaction beyond usual circles and breaking down barriers.

Community engagement flourishes through volunteerism and active participation at UK sports events. Volunteers often help with event logistics, while fans unite in support of teams, reinforcing a collective spirit. This active involvement boosts feelings of belonging and pride, essential components of social cohesion.

Economic Benefits for Local Communities

Local communities often experience significant economic benefits from hosting sports events. These occasions can create a substantial boost to local business as visitors spend on accommodation, food, and retail. For example, hotels and restaurants see increased demand, which translates into higher revenues. This influx stimulates the service sector and encourages investments in infrastructure.

Another key aspect is job creation. Temporary roles in event management, security, and hospitality emerge, providing employment opportunities that can extend beyond the event. This helps reduce local unemployment and improve skills among residents.

Sports tourism also plays a crucial role in driving these economic gains. Fans and participants travel to attend competitions, often extending their stay to explore the area. This influx of visitors injects money into the local economy, benefiting both small and large enterprises.

Some cities have witnessed urban regeneration linked to hosting events. Investments in stadiums and public spaces often revitalize neglected neighborhoods, attracting new businesses and residents. Such transformation underscores how strategic sports tourism and related activities can foster sustainable economic growth.

Enhancing Physical Activity and Public Health

Promoting physical activity through high-profile sports events has become a pivotal strategy in advancing public health. These events serve as powerful platforms to inspire communities to adopt more active lifestyles. Exposure to large-scale competitions and athlete role models increases awareness and motivation for sports participation.

Public health campaigns often align with these events, using the heightened interest to encourage exercise and wellness. Such initiatives can include organized community programs, media outreach, and incentivized challenges that encourage regular physical activity. By tapping into the excitement around major sporting moments, health authorities deliver messages that resonate more effectively.

Growing evidence supports that heightened sports participation contributes to improved health outcomes at the community level. Increased activity helps to reduce risks related to cardiovascular diseases, obesity, and mental health conditions, while also fostering social cohesion and well-being. When health initiatives leverage this connection, they promote lasting behavioral changes that benefit broad populations.

Ultimately, integrating major sports events into public health strategies can amplify the impact of campaigns targeting physical activity, turning inspiration into tangible health improvements across communities.

Supporting Mental Health and Well-being

Collective experiences have a profound impact on mental health and overall well-being. When individuals participate in communal activities, such as inclusive sports events, they often report heightened feelings of connection and reduced feelings of loneliness. These shared moments foster a sense of belonging, which is a critical component of mental health.

Community pride plays a significant role in shaping individual well-being. Feeling proud of one’s neighborhood or group can boost self-esteem and contribute to emotional resilience. This pride grows when members come together for a common purpose, reinforcing their identity and social bonds.

Many initiatives now focus on addressing social isolation by promoting inclusive sports events that welcome participants of all ages and abilities. These programs not only encourage physical activity but also create opportunities for social support networks to grow. Social support is vital for mental health, as it provides emotional comfort and practical assistance, helping individuals navigate stressful situations more effectively.

By nurturing community pride and facilitating supportive environments, these initiatives offer practical solutions to bolster both mental health and well-being through collective engagement.

Building Local Pride and Long-term Community Development

Hosting national and international sports events generates significant local pride, uniting communities with a shared sense of achievement. These occasions go beyond mere entertainment; they serve as catalysts for community development by inspiring participation and boosting local morale. When residents see their hometown spotlighted on a global stage, a stronger emotional connection to their area often develops, fostering ongoing engagement.

The true power lies in legacy projects—upgraded sports facilities and newly established community programs that outlive the events themselves. Such infrastructures provide accessible, high-quality spaces for physical activity, youth engagement, and social interaction. They create opportunities for diverse groups to connect, promoting healthier and more vibrant neighborhoods.

Research from multiple official reports confirms that sustainable social impact arises when investments target long-term benefits. For example, programs focusing on youth sports often correlate with reduced crime rates and improved educational outcomes. This demonstrates that hosting major events can be a smart strategy not just for instant prestige but for enduring empowerment of communities through inclusive development.
